The one standing at where the door used to be was the Demon Lord, our Demon Lord. Her long silver hair looked darker than usual in contrast with the Ice Lady’s and so did her clothes.

“I guess I’ll use your name too, Anastasia.”

“I can’t care less about it. After all, soon you’ll stop talking once for all.”

Our Demon Lord, Beatrice, whose name I’ve just found out, let out a long sigh and mover her right hand as if she was dusting of the air, at that moment, the crystals and ice that were on the floor melted and evaporated, leaving the floor with no trace of them.

“Are you trying to show off or something like that?”

“Of course not~! It's just that it would be a shame if I ended up winning because you tripped or something like that. Whakaka~!” 

“Mhmp!”

Suddenly, the Ice Lady was really close to where I was. She was ferociously charging while thrusting her katana, and sadly, I was right in the middle between her and her objective.

Before I could do or say anything, I was thrown into the air by an invisible force, and ended up landing where the girls were. No, they weren't in the same place from the start, they were also pushed to that point, in other words, we were reunited on purpose.

Their legs were severely hurt, but somehow, there was no blood coming out of them, however, it seems that they won't be able to stand up and fight. No, even if they were able to stand up, this is clearly a battle that they won't be able to join even if they wanted to.

Less than a second after that, we heard the loud and heavy sound of two pieces of steel clashing into each other with inhuman strength.

“It seems that you still have those godlike reflexes of yours…”

“You attacked my servants, now you'll pay, Ana!”

“They were hurt because they are weak and there's no room for the weaks in this world, you should already know that!”

The Ice Lady jumped back and looked at the rusty and old sword that was on my Lady’s hand. It woulndt be a mistake to call it a cursed sword, because I felt chills down my spine just by looking at it, and I could swear that there was a weird ominous aura surrounding the edge.

What's more mysterious about the sword, is that my Lady is not carrying a sword holster on her belt or anywhere that can be seen, and since I didn't see her unsheathing it or something like that, it feels as if she was able to manifest it on her hand at will.

“A cursed sword... I see. Are you trying to drain my mana or something like that? Unlucky for you, there's no sword in this world that would be able to eat one of my spells!”

“Why won't you try it, Ana~?”

“Tsh! You little brat…”

Anastasia looked extremely furious, while, on the other hand, Beatrice had a playful smile drawn on her face. Agh, that line felt awfully weird, I guess I’ll stick with the same naming sense that I was using before that…

The Ice Lady put her katana on her shoulder and I felt how everything stopped once more. No, that's not true, I felt as if everything was going to stop, but in the end, nothing happened. Now, the Ice Lady has one of her knees leaned on the floor, a painful expression drawn on her face, and she is clearly short of breath.

“How…?! How did you…?!”

She was so angry that it looked as if her eyes were covered by flames and sparks. Her pride had clearly been hurt, and she was even kneeling before her opponent. What's worse, was the fact my Lady hasn't done anything yet, she was just holding her sword.

“Oh, this~? This guy is a glutton, you know? I’ve been feeding him for years. Sadly, I cant use any magic while holding him... However, you better dont get cut by him, that won't be nice~”

It was so obvious that our Lady was mocking her that it hurt. It was so obvious, that it was no surprise that the Ice Lady fell for such a clear bait.

“Thats…! It doesn't matter, I’ll take you down, no matter what!”

The Ice Lady stood up and charged once more towards our Lady.

Both of them moved so fast that it was hard to follow them with sight, but the sound of the clashing steel was so constant and heavy that there was no doubt about the abilities of those two Demon Lords even if you couldn't actually watch them fight each other.

However, only the Ice Lady was taking the offensive. On the other hand, our Lady was just standing there, moving her sword in order to block every single strike, and with every block, the ground around her cracked and broke.

“This is…”

“This is clearly out of our league, right…?”

“Yeah…”

That's right, there was nothing we could do to help our Lady into that ferocious fight.
